Patriots counter-demonstrate outside French Consulate in Toronto, as National Council of Moslem Canadians protest Pres. Macron’s support for free speech & denunciation of Moslem extremists beheading Christians and free speech supporters.

Patriots counter-demonstrate outside French Consulate in Toronto, as National Council of Moslem Canadians protest Pres. Macron’s support for free speech & denunciation of Moslem extremists beheading Christians and free speech supporters. Vive la France